Family medicine

A family physician is concerned with the general health needs of people of all ages. Focusing on the primary care of you and your family, he or she can refer you to a specialist or community resources when appropriate.

Family doctors receive training in six broad areas: community medicine, internal medicine, obstetrics and gynecology, pediatrics, psychiatry and surgery.

Obstetrics and gynecology (OB/GYN)

Some women choose an obstetrician/gynecologist as a main health care provider. OB/GYNs are doctors who specialize in the care of the female reproductive system, including pregnancy and childbirth. Nurse practitioners also can specialize in health care for women.

Family medicine

Our family doctor addresses general health care and wellness needs for all ages. This includes in-office care for minor skin problems, as well as helping you manage conditions like diabetes and high blood pressure.

General surgery

Whether it's for breast cancer or prostate cancer, our general surgeon is there for you before, during and after surgery. Surgical practices are minimally invasive so that patient recovery is as short as possible.

Infectious diseases

Our infectious disease specialist helps adults with complex infections, especially those related to diabetes, cancer, prosthetic joints and bones. A referral from your primary care doctor is required for prevention, minimizing infection risks, antibiotics, treatments and other services.
